    Staying at non-DVC resorts?

    My husband and I are very tempted by BLT as we are huge Contemporary Resort fans and love being able to walk to MK.

    One thing that's holding us back from buying is that we still like to check out different resorts that we've never been to before. I know you can use DVC points to stay at other DVC resorts, but can you also use them to stay at non-DVC Disney hotels (like staying at the Poly, for instance)?

    Re: Staying at non-DVC resorts?

    my family and i are also very tempted by BLT. It looks spectacular and you can't beat the location for MK access!

    As a DVC member, you can use points to stay at any resort as Mckayla stated but it is more expensive. There is a $100 booking fee to stay at a non-DVC resort at WDW in addition to the points, and you don't get as much room or the other DVC amenities that are normally included. When my wife and I looked at buying in, this was one concern as we LOVE the Polynesian (Ohana, please!). So far, though, we have enjoyed exploring all the other DVC resorts and haven't had the urge to go back to the Poly yet. The other thing to consider is that it looks as though Disney is committed to building DVC properties as opposed to other park resorts, so your options as a DVC member are only going to broaden.

    Re: Staying at non-DVC resorts?

    The points required to stay at the non-Disney deluxe resorts generally cost more per night than a 1BR at a DVC resort, and in some cases more than a 2BR! And you are just getting a standard studio-type room.

    For instance, one night in Value season in a garden view Poly room is 38 points (2009 points, 2010 points still not released), so 266 for a week. Less than that would get you a week in a 1BR at Beach Club Villas in Adventure/Choice/Dream seasons (both 2009 and 2010 charts). DVC and non-DVC seasons do not line up entirely and are called different things to avoid confusion, but those three cover everything in Value season except late July/early August, and cover far more elsewhere.

    If your trip wouldn't include a Friday or Saturday night, the difference is even more remarkable (DVC charges more points for those nights).
